Key Responsibilities Teach English and Read 180 to students in grades 7/8, fostering a love for learning and promoting academic excellence. Develop and implement engaging lesson plans that cater to diverse learning needs, ensuring that all students make progress. Utilize Read 180, a comprehensive reading intervention program, to support students who are below grade level in reading. Assess student progress, identifying areas of strength and weakness, and adjust instruction accordingly. Collaborate with colleagues to develop curriculum, share best practices, and drive student success. Participate in leadership development opportunities, such as curriculum facilitator and teacher facilitator roles, to grow professionally and contribute to the district's growth. Engage with the local community, fostering strong relationships with parents, guardians, and other stakeholders to support student well-being. Essential Qualifications To be considered for this role, you must: Possess a valid Connecticut State Certification in English Language Arts (015 ELA 7-12) or be willing to obtain one. Hold a relevant degree and have a minimum number of years of teaching experience, as per the district's salary schedule. Compensation and Benefits We offer a competitive salary range of $48,708 - $101,297 per year, contingent on degree and years of experience. Additional benefits include: Community support and resources. Special federal/state loan forgiveness programs. Home buyer programs.
